Care Ltd Tells Us Why Lived Experience is Not a Buzzword

Last month, The Clothworkers’ Foundation brought together nearly 200 amazing people representing charities from its open, proactive, and regular grants programmes. They came from all corners of the UK to connect with each other and celebrate their work.

It was an inspiring day for The Foundation, as we heard about the impact our funding can have. Anne Bickerstaffe, Chief Executive at Care Ltd in Grimsby, told us about the work the charity does to support its community members in an area of Lincolnshire facing extreme deprivation, and how the team's lived experience helps them to understand and support the people they help.

Anne said, "It's not just what we do. It's who does it. And we have the most amazing team in our charity. Many of you have lived experience. Now I know that's a buzz word and it's often used nowadays, but actually, for us, it's really meaningful. And I think about Tenancy Officer Anita, who came to us 24 years ago with her 2-year-old child, and she was homeless. And she said to me when I first started in the job, she said, 'If I ever forget what it feels like to walk through that door and know how terrifying that is to ask for help', she said, 'I'm going to leave this work.'

And you should see her with people. She's just got a heart of gold. No matter what issues and difficulties people walk through the door with, she just has love and compassion and understanding for them."
